Philip Hiro Nozuka is an American-Canadian actor and writer born in Queens, New York but now lives in Toronto. He is a graduate of the Etobicoke School of the Arts for Musical Theatre and is currently studying acting at the prestigious National Theatre School of Canada in Montreal.

Nozuka played Chester on , and was a crush of Manny Santos.

Nozuka is the nephew of musician Mike Stern and Leni Stern. He is the brother of singer George Nozuka who is signed to HC Entertainment, and singer Justin Nozuka whose debut album "Holly" was released in 2007. George and Justin were in a season 4 episode of "" "Modern Love" with Philip, playing Chester's brothers, Chuck and Chad.
